ISTANBUL, Turkey, April 3 (UPI) -- The Olympic torch arrived Thursday in Istanbul from Kazakhstan on its global journey toward Beijing for the August Games.
A chartered plane landed at the Ataturk International Airport and the flame was carried off by Beijing Organizing Committee of Olympic Games Executive Vice President Jiang Xiaoyu, Turkey's Hurriyet newspaper reported.
Various Turkish athletes were to run a 11-mile relay through the city before lighting the city's Olympic cauldron at Taksim Square, the report said.
The Olympic torch flame was lit March 24 at the Ancient Olympia in Greece and after a six-day tour of Greece was given to Beijing on March 31. Some 21,880 torch bearers will participate in the international 130-day relay before it's carried into Beijing's National Stadium on Aug. 8 for the beginning of the Games, the report said.
Friday, the torch and its contingent are to arrive in St. Petersburg, Russia.
